McLaren struggling with 2013 car admits Button
By Editor on Friday, February 22, 2013 Jenson Button has admitted McLaren is grappling with its new car for 2013.
Unlike most other main rivals, notably Red Bull and Ferrari, McLaren – whose British driver Button won the 2012 finale in Brazil – did not simply ‘evolve' last year's car for the new season.
Red Bull's outspoken Dr Helmut Marko said this week he didn't understand why McLaren changed so much between 2012 and 2013.
Mark Webber agrees: 'This sport is hard enough – and the cars difficult enough to understand technically – without taking risks unnecessarily.'
Indeed, things are going well in the Red Bull camp.
